> Memsys5 is also faster than your global system memory allocator
> (before the extra overhead of zeroing, at least).  But on the other
> hand, you have to know the maximum amount of memory SQLite will want
> at the very beginning, and that memory will be used only by SQLite and
> not other parts of your application, so memory utilization is not as
> efficient.
